Description: B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a harvesting device for a harvester, and can be used for a self-removing combine. 2. Description of the Related Art A conventional mowing device in a self-removing type combine has a clipper-type mowing device arranged on the bottom side of a mowing portion provided with a raising device, a grain culm conveying device, and the like. [0003] Since the clipper-type reaper is long in the left-right direction, it is necessary to attach and support not only the left and right ends but also the left and right intermediate parts in the case of a large cutting width. [0004] As described above, the reaping device in the conventional harvester needs to be mounted on the bottom side of the reaping part, and must be mounted and supported not only on the left and right ends but also on the left and right intermediate parts. Therefore, the reaper could not be easily attached and detached. Therefore, an object of the present invention is to make it possible to mount the reaper securely and to easily attach and detach the reaper. First, the configuration will be described. As shown in the drawing, the mounting frame 2 is a horizontally long frame in which the pipe material is positioned horizontally, and a portion near both ends thereof is attached to the distal ends of the support rods 4a and 4b fixed to the body 3; A plurality of weeding support rods 1a, 1b, 1c, 1d protruding and extending forward in the traveling direction are attached to each of the cutting rows in a horizontal direction. The weed supporting rods 1a, 1b, 1c, 1
Although not shown, d has a configuration in which a weeding rod is attached to the tip end so that the culm in the field can be weeded with the forward movement. The pedestal 5 includes the mounting frame 2 and the support rods 4a, 4a.
It is attached from above to the connecting and fixing part with b, and both are further firmly fixed. As shown in the drawing, the cutting device 8 is a horizontally long clipper-type cutting device 8, in which an upper cutting blade 6 a and a lower cutting blade 6 b are overlapped on a cutting blade support 9, and a blade holding device 10 is provided.
And can be reciprocated in the opposite directions to each other, and are arranged on the front side of the mounting frame 2. The mowing device 8 is provided with a U-shaped locking member 11 at the rear of the intermediate portion of the cutting blade support 9 to
1 is engaged with the mounting bracket 12 of the mounting frame 2 and mounted. In this case, the locking tool 11 is attached to the cutting blade support 9 with the U-shape opened forward.
In a state in which it is engaged with the mounting bracket 12, it can be suspended as shown in FIG. As shown in FIG. 1, the locking member 11 and the mounting member 12 may be attached to the side of the reaper 8 in plan view. The reaper 8 is detachably mounted on a mounting plate 13 having both ends fixed to both ends of the mounting frame 2 by locking screws 14. The connecting plate 15 has a base portion attached to the upper portion of the cutting blade support 9 with screws, and an engagement hole 16 is formed at a tip portion protruding forward. The connecting plate 15 is configured such that the engaging hole 16 at the distal end position can be selectively engaged with the adjusting holes 17a, 17b formed above and below the separating plate 18 provided on the weeding rod supporting rods 1b, 1c. . When the mowing device 8 reciprocates the power transmission lots 20a and 20b back and forth, the mowing blade drive arms 7a and 7b operate around the bearing support to drive the driving brackets 19a and 19b in the left and right directions, respectively. Therefore, the reaping device 8 includes the upper cutting blade 6.
a and the lower cutting blade 6b start reciprocating movements in the opposite directions, respectively, and both enter the cutting posture. When the cutting device 8 moves forward, the cutting device 8 advances while cutting the root of the cereal stem by the cooperative action of the upper cutting blade 6a and the lower cutting blade 6b. In this case, the cutting device 8 reciprocates in opposite directions. As a result, the vibrations caused by the swinging are canceled each other, and the whole vibration can be prevented. The grain stalks mowed as described above are transported backward and upward through a transport path that is collected at the center side of the machine by a grain stalk transport device (not shown).
